Output 95dcb83013da90568ef929be9accce604423243b045f6ec8442f3a9495f9c6c3:35

value
10209409
script pubkey
OP_0 OP_PUSHBYTES_20 b4ca00cfe121d250ab19a1e68cddefb788d39314
address
bc1qkn9qpnlpy8f9p2ce58ngeh00k7yd8yc5g2fv0w
transaction
95dcb83013da90568ef929be9accce604423243b045f6ec8442f3a9495f9c6c3
spent
true